Front-End Web Designer

PCR is currently seeking a strong Front End Web Designer for our Charlotte based client. The ideal candidate will have a strong portfolio, demonstrating clean corporate UI design skills. The primary function will be maintenance of the current site(s), as well as new development and design of supplemental sites. Extensive Web design experience is a requirement.

Responsibilities:

  • Create UI solutions that compliment both business and customer needs
  • Gather functionality requirements
  • Define Website information architecture
  • Produce detailed product wireframes, prototypes and specifications
  • Present and articulate wireframes and specifications
  • Design the look-and-feel of the Websites keeping in mind, user goals and restrictions, latest Web design trends, business goals and application environment
  • Ability to hand-code HTML/CSS comps
  • Create style guides to ensure consistency throughout sites
  • Keep up to date with latest trends and strategies in the domain name, Web services, Web media and domain parking industries
  • Share knowledge of personal specialties with coworkers

Required Skills and Background:

  • 3+ years of education or job experience in Web design or a related field
  • 2+ years working with HTML/CSS driven layouts
  • 2+ years developing and implementing usability and navigation solutions
  • Experience with CSS, HTML, hand coding, rapid prototyping, debugging cross browser compatibility issues
  • JavaScript & JQuery experience a plus
  • AJAX experience a plus
  • Experience incorporating Web 2.0 technologies into Web design a plus
  • Experience designing in a .NET Web environment a plus
  • Strong design skills a must
  • Practical experience in graphic design software including Photoshop, Illustrator, CS4
  • Ability to accomplish timely delivery of projects in a fast paced tight deadline environment
  • High degree of problem solving skill and sound judgment a must
  • Ability to consider multi-departmental objectives
  • Flexibility when incorporating design suggestions and critiques
  • Strong attention to detail a must
  • Bachelor's Degree preferred
